Summit Mount Kilimanjaro VIA the Rongai Route Overview

The Rongai Route is one of the lesser-traveled paths on Mount Kilimanjaro, offering a serene and less crowded experience. It starts from the northern side of the mountain, near the Kenyan border, and is known for its beautiful landscapes, wildlife sightings, and gradual ascent. The route provides trekkers with a unique perspective of Kilimanjaro, combining scenic views of the surrounding plains with diverse ecosystems as you ascend. The Rongai Route is ideal for those looking for a quieter trekking experience while still experiencing the mountain’s iconic challenges.

Best Time to Use the Rongai Route

The best time to climb Kilimanjaro via the Rongai Route is during the dry seasons, specifically January to March (warmest, fewer crowds) and June to October (best, more stable weather). Because it is on the northern side, it is drier than other routes, making it an excellent, reliable option for year-round trekking. 

Route Success Rate

  • 6-Day Rongai Route: Around 65% to 70%. The shorter itinerary leaves less time for acclimatization, increasing the risk of altitude sickness and lowering the chances of a successful summit.

DAY 1: Rongai Gate (1,950m) to Simba Camp (2,620m)

Begin with a scenic drive through Nale Muru Village to the Kilimanjaro National Park Gate. After completing permit formalities, trek through lush rainforest to Simba Camp at the edge of the moorland zone, offering stunning views over the Kenyan plains.

  • Distance: 7 km / 5 mi
  • Duration: 3-4 hours
  • Habitat: Rainforest
  • Elevation: 1,997 m / 6,552 ft to 2,635 m / 8,645 ft
  • Altitude Gain: 638 m

DAY 2: Simba Camp (2,620m) to Kikelewa Camp (3,600m)

A steady ascent through the moorland brings views of Kibo Peak and the eastern ice fields. As vegetation thins, you’ll reach Second Cave Camp, where temperatures begin to drop as you near higher altitudes.

  • Distance: 5.8 km / 3.6 mi
  • Duration: 5-6 hours
  • Habitat: Moorland
  • Elevation: 2,635 m / 8,645 ft to 3,487 m / 11,440 ft
  • Altitude Gain: 852 m

DAY 3: Kikelewa Camp (3,600m) to Mawenzi Tarn Camp (4,330m)

A shorter trek day in semi-desert terrain, with the mesmerizing views of the Eastern ice fields drawing you closer to Kilimanjaro’s upper reaches. Be sure to communicate any symptoms of altitude sickness with your guide.

  • Distance: 3.3 km / 2 mi
  • Duration: 3-4 hours
  • Habitat: Semi-Desert
  • Elevation: 3,487 m / 11,440 ft to 3,936 m / 12,913 ft
  • Altitude Gain: 449 m

DAY 4: Mawenzi Tarn Camp (4,330m) to Kibo Hut (4,700m)

Your journey continues through the sparse Alpine desert, arriving at Kibo Huts near the crater wall. The remainder of the day is spent preparing for your midnight summit attempt, ensuring your gear is ready and recharging headlamp batteries for the challenging night ahead.

  • Distance: 6.7 km / 4.2 mi
  • Duration: 4-5 hours
  • Habitat: Alpine Desert
  • Elevation: 3,936 m / 12,913 ft to 5,174 m / 16,975 ft
  • Altitude Gain: 1,238 m

DAY 5: Kibo Hut (4,700m) to Uhuru Peak (5,895m) to Horombo Hut (3,720m)

A midnight start begins your summit journey past the Rebmann and Ratzel glaciers, eventually reaching Stella Point with a breathtaking sunrise. After a short break, continue to Uhuru Peak, the highest point on Kilimanjaro. Celebrate this incredible achievement before a steep descent to Horombo Huts for a well-deserved rest.

  • Ascent: 4 km / 2.5 mi | 5-7 hours
  • Descent: 15.75 km / 9.8 mi | 5-6 hours
  • Habitat: Glaciers, Snow-Capped Summit
  • Elevation Gain: 721 m to reach 5,895 m / 19,341 ft
  • Elevation Loss: 2,174 m

DAY 6: Horombo Hut (3,720m) to Marangu Gate (1,870m)

A final descent through lush rainforest brings you to Marangu Gate, where you’ll receive your summit certificate and say goodbye to your crew. A transfer will take you back to Moshi for a relaxing hot shower, dinner, and celebration.

  • Distance: 20 km / 12.5 mi
  • Duration: 6-7 hours
  • Habitat: Rainforest
  • Elevation Loss: 1,816 m
